According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Kan Wari village is 104989. Kan Wari village is located in Pirawa tehsil of Jhalawar district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Pirawa (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Jhalawar. As per 2009 stats, Kanwari is the gram panchayat of Kan Wari village.
The total geographical area of village is 340.5 hectares. Kan Wari has a total population of 900 peoples, out of which male population is 470 while female population is 430.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 914 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of kan wari village is 63.22% out of which 76.60% males and 48.60% females are literate. There are about 182 houses in kan wari village. Pincode of kan wari village locality is 326513.
When it comes to administration, Kan Wari village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Kan Wari village comes under Jhalrapatan Vidhan Sabha constituency & Jhalawar-Baran Lok Sabha constituency. Bhawani Mandi is nearest town to kan wari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.
